I found a church singing a song called "Ready to Go" on YouTube and would love to find a download of the song. Can anyone help me?

Verse 1:
I know a place of wondrous beauty, in a land not far away.
And although I've never been there, it won't be long and I'll go to stay.
The streets are gold, the walls of jasper, a mansion there awaits for me.
But most of all I'll see Jesus, the one who died to set me free.

Chorus:
I'm ready to go, to that place called heaven.
I'm waiting the call for me to come on home.
And I'll be free from trouble and heartache,
I'll sail away, no more to roam.

Verse 2:
I'll be free from sin's temptation, I'll never have a pain or a care.
I'll rest forever by the river, oh don't that make you wanna go there.
I'll see my friends and all of our loved ones, who are waiting on that shore.
They are singing glad hosannas, tears are gone, we'll cry no more.
